Your Role
Key responsibilities in your new role
* Develop software and algorithms for the automated physical design of analog integrated circuits as well as discrete power devices and charge-coupled devices
* Build and optimize spatial indexing and graph-based engines: sweep-line operations, interval/segment trees, R-tree-based querying, planar graph construction/analysis, and matching algorithms for constraints like symmetry and alignment
* Model complex AMS layout rules via constraint programming, implement and tune Gecode or OR-Tools CP-SAT models; develop custom propagators where needed, establish diagnostics and KPIs for model quality and solver performance
* Parallelize compute-intensive kernels using OpenMP and standard parallel algorithms; optimize memory behavior and validate scalability on Linux/LSF clusters
* Establish testing and quality practices for geometry kernels and CP models: create unit tests and fuzzing for geometric edge cases
* Improve existing software modules including refactoring, testing and maintenance of existing code
* Communicate and collaborate with our international analog design automation team to guarantee the success of all the above activities
Your Profile
Qualifications and skills to help you succeed
* A deg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science or similar, Doctorate (Ph.D.) strongly preferred
* Minimum 3–5 years of algorithm development experience directly applicable to AMS-EDA, especially computational geometry for analog layout synthesis, constraint programming and solver use (e.g., Gecode, OR-Tools CP-SAT) and CPU-only parallel algorithms in modern C++ using OpenMP and standard parallel algorithms (C++17/C++20)
* Deep knowledge of spatial and graph data structures (e.g., sweep-line, interval/segment trees, R-trees, planar graphs, matching/flow) relevant to analog physical design
* Advanced knowledge of Python GUI programming and Cadence SKILL, as well as knowledge of the Cadence Virtuoso software suite (schematic and layout entry), is required
* Experience in quantum computing, machine learning, artificial neural networks and reinforcement learning, as well as associated software such as model development in Python/Torch
* Familiarity with the Unix/Linux operating system as a user and administrator, as well as experience in shell scripting and the use of LSF server farms
* Fluent English language skills, German is a plus
